Rachel Francis in Indianapolis, IN, USA

We found 1 person named Rachel Francis in Indianapolis, IN. View Rachelā€™s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.

Filter
Browse by State
Browse by City
Indianapolis, IN
Rachel L Francis is a thirty-four year old American. 5 people are related to this person according to our records. Rachel L Francis has a residential history of 1 address in 1 city and now lives at Indianapolis, IN. Rachel can be reached via 2 phone numbers. The current phone number is (407) 365-5139.
Current & Previous Addresses

7015 Barth Ave, Indianapolis, IN, 46227 (current address)

3869 Becontree Pl, Oviedo, FL, 32765 (2015 - 2019)

Phone Numbers
(407) 365-5139 (317) 504-7097

Birth, Death, and Divorce Records for Rachel Francis

Sponsored by Ancestry.com

Rachel Francis, Q&A

Frequently asked questions for Rachel Francis

Born on April 21, 1990, Rachel Francis is 34 years old now.

Try calling Rachel Francis at (407) 365-5139. There are 1 more phone number available for Rachel Francis.

Rachel Francis has been living at 7015 Barth Ave, Indianapolis, Indiana, 46227 since 2020.

Rachel Francis used to live at the following address: 3869 Becontree Pl, Oviedo, Florida, 32765.

The following people are indicated as the relatives of Rachel Francis: Kimberly Francis, Oviedo (FL), Lauren Francis, Oviedo (FL), Aaron Francis, Indianapolis (IN), Kaylee Francis, Oviedo (FL), Dale Francis, Oviedo (FL).